About MiChild at Newhouse Nursery
Newhouse Nursery, proudly rated as “Good” by Ofsted, has a capacity of 48 children and has been part of the MiChild Family since 2020. We value ourselves on being a home from home setting. We have recently had a refurbishment across the nursery and we are proud of our expansive garden area, accessible from all rooms. This outdoor space is unique to Newhouse Nursery as it offers our children and staff countless opportunities for engaging in outdoor learning activities, allowing us to immerse ourselves in imaginative play. We are conveniently situated close to Baines Primary School and St George’s High School. How to prepare for a job interview at MIChild Group
✨Know Your EYFS Inside Out
Make sure you brush up on the Early Years Foundation Stage (EYFS) framework. Understand its principles and how they apply to child development. Being able to discuss specific examples of how you've implemented these in your previous roles will show your expertise.
✨Showcase Your Passion for Child Development
During the interview, let your passion for nurturing children's potential shine through. Share personal anecdotes or experiences that highlight your commitment to early years education. This will resonate with MiChild's ethos of compassion and ambition.
✨Prepare for Safeguarding Questions
Given the importance of safeguarding in early years settings, be ready to discuss your knowledge and experience in this area. Familiarise yourself with current safeguarding policies and be prepared to explain how you would handle various scenarios.
